I've got a problem with my 90 series and I think it's got to do with the fly-by-wire throttle. The reason I think that is because I don't get the symptoms when I drive using the cruise control. The symptoms are like you are running out of fuel when you are just maintaining speed without depressing the pedal, like not coasting and not accelerating but right in between, car accelerates without any hesitation. Have changed the fuel filter twice but this hasn't cleared the problem and it seems worst between 1700 to 2200 RPM and at town speed around 60 kph you can see on the taco revs surge 200 RPM and feel the car surge.
Will pull the plugs on it and give them a good spray of electrical contact cleaner and see if that makes any difference. The engine light has never come on during normal operation and the only time I got it to come on was when I was play around with it under the dash. At the hefty price of around $750 for it I will try a few things first.
